Started my bike for the first time in a week or so. It seemed to take a fraction longer than normal to fire up, and when it did the idle speed sat at 2,500 rpm for perhaps five seconds before dropping to normal. Each time I closed the throttle and let the bike idle (e.g. junctions) it did the same. rolling on and off the throttle when moving along was particulalry jumpy, and it felt a little bit rougher everywhere.

No warning lights on, by the way.

After about five minutes, everything returned to normal - smooth, proper idle speed, no lurching.

Other than that, it's been perfect for 5,000-odd miles in four months.

Any suggestions? Has this happened to anyone else?
